Assistant/Associate/ Full Professor of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ation (NTT) - Spine/Pain Management
The Department of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ation (PM&R) at the University of Missouri is seeking a dedicated and experienced physician to join our team as a full-time Clinical Faculty member. This position will oversee the Spine Program at the Missouri Orthopedic Institute (MOI) and provide clinical care for patients with spine conditions and/or comprehensive pain management needs.
Key Responsibilities:
- Lead and manage the Spine Program at MOI, ensuring the highest standards of patient care.
- Provide clinical care for patients with spine-related issues and comprehensive pain management.
- Educate and mentor rotating residents and other student learners in a clinical setting, fostering the next generation of healthcare professionals.
Minimum Qualifications:
- M.D. or D.O. in Physiatry.
- Fellowship training in Spine or Comprehensive Pain Management is highly valued.

Our Community
Columbia is rated by Forbes magazine as the fifth best small city for business and careers in America and is consistently rated a top place to live by Money Magazine, boasting a low cost of living, a vibrant community, and nationally renowned public schools. Columbia is an ideal college town that combines small-town comforts, and community spirit, with big-city feel, activities, and resources. Our community is energetic and engaged, packed with restaurants and entertainment venues, and hosts more than a dozen annual festivals.
